Javascript 如何解决我的json服务器的eNONT错误?

Javascript 如何解决我的json服务器的eNONT错误?,javascript,json,database,vue.js,json-server,Javascript,Json,Database,Vue.js,Json Server,我在下面得到了这个错误 PS C:\Users\Tan Shi Yu\Github\shopaway> npx json-server --watch data/db.json \{^_^}/ hi! Loading data/db.json Oops, data/db.json doesn't seem to exist Creating data/db.json with some default data Error: ENOENT: no such file

我在下面得到了这个错误

PS C:\Users\Tan Shi Yu\Github\shopaway> npx json-server --watch data/db.json

  \{^_^}/ hi!

  Loading data/db.json
  Oops, data/db.json doesn't seem to exist
  Creating data/db.json with some default data

Error: ENOENT: no such file or directory, open 'data/db.json'
    at Object.openSync (fs.js:498:3)
    at Object.writeFileSync (fs.js:1524:35)
    at C:\Users\Tan Shi Yu\Github\shopaway\node_modules\json-server\lib\cli\utils\load.js:44:12
    at new Promise (<anonymous>)
    at module.exports (C:\Users\Tan Shi Yu\Github\shopaway\node_modules\json-server\lib\cli\utils\load.js:38:10)
    at start (C:\Users\Tan Shi Yu\Github\shopaway\node_modules\json-server\lib\cli\run.js:112:12)
    at module.exports (C:\Users\Tan Shi Yu\Github\shopaway\node_modules\json-server\lib\cli\run.js:149:3)
    at module.exports (C:\Users\Tan Shi Yu\Github\shopaway\node_modules\json-server\lib\cli\index.js:86:3)
    at Object.<anonymous> (C:\Users\Tan Shi Yu\Github\shopaway\node_modules\json-server\lib\cli\bin.js:6:14)
    at Module._compile (internal/modules/cjs/loader.js:1068:30) {
  errno: -4058,
  syscall: 'open',
  code: 'ENOENT',
  path: 'data/db.json'
}
PS C:\Users\Tan Shi Yu\Github\shopaway>npx json服务器——监视数据/db.json
\{^{^}/嗨!
加载数据/db.json
哎呀,data/db.json似乎不存在
使用一些默认数据创建data/db.json
错误:enoint:没有这样的文件或目录,请打开“data/db.json”
在Object.openSync(fs.js:498:3)
在Object.writeFileSync(fs.js:1524:35)
在C:\Users\Tan Shi Yu\Github\shopaway\node\u modules\json server\lib\cli\utils\load.js:44:12
在新的承诺下(


我可以知道我是否做错了什么吗?谢谢!

这并不能保证在运行npx/deployment后data/db.sjon位于正确的位置。请检查这是否也是正确的。另外,您在命令行指定的要监视的文件不在src,因为可以看到命令行路径是C:\Users\Tan Shi Yu\Github\shopaway与C:\Users\Tan Shi Yu\Github\shopaway\src不一样-可能这也是一个问题你好,谢谢你的评论。我想我最终通过将src放在data/db.json文件前面解决了这个问题。